How Structural Damage Is Identified
Structural damage may occur during:
-
Front-end collisions
-
Side-impact accidents
-
Rear-end collisions
-
Rollover accidents
Even relatively minor collisions can sometimes affect structural alignment or suspension mounting points.
Collision repair technicians typically begin with a visual inspection followed by computerized measuring procedures to identify deviations from factory specifications.
According to the National Highway Traffic Safety Administration, vehicle structural systems are designed to help manage crash forces and protect occupants during accidents.
Repair facilities may inspect:
-
Frame rails
-
Crumple zones
-
Structural supports
-
Suspension mounting areas
-
Weld locations
Some structural issues may only become visible after damaged panels are removed during disassembly.
Computerized Measuring Systems and Structural Analysis
Modern collision repair facilities use computerized measuring systems to compare the vehicle’s dimensions to manufacturer specifications.
These systems help technicians identify:
-
Structural distortion
-
Frame movement
-
Alignment shifts
-
Suspension positioning issues
Accurate measurements are important because even small structural variations may affect vehicle handling, wheel alignment, and crash performance.
According to I-CAR, precise measuring procedures are essential during structural repairs to ensure vehicles are restored properly after collision damage.
Structural Repair and Frame Straightening Procedures
Once the damage is identified, technicians may use specialized frame machines and hydraulic equipment to restore the structure.
Structural repair procedures may include:
-
Frame straightening
-
Sectioning procedures
-
Structural component replacement
-
Weld repairs
-
Alignment corrections
Repair methods vary depending on the manufacturer’s repair guidelines and the severity of the damage.
In some situations, structural components may require replacement instead of repair if the damage exceeds manufacturer repair limits.
Importance of OEM Repair Procedures
Vehicle manufacturers often provide detailed repair procedures for structural repairs.
These procedures may specify:
-
Approved repair locations
-
Welding techniques
-
Replacement requirements
-
Structural repair limitations
-
Material handling procedures
The OEM Collision Repair Information website provides manufacturer repair information used throughout the collision repair industry.
Following OEM repair procedures helps ensure the repaired structure performs as intended during future collisions.
Vehicle Safety Systems and Post-Repair Inspections
Modern vehicles frequently contain advanced safety systems that may require recalibration after structural repairs.
These systems may include:
-
Blind spot monitoring
-
Lane departure warning
-
Adaptive cruise control
-
Collision mitigation systems
Technicians may also perform:
-
Wheel alignments
-
Suspension inspections
-
Diagnostic scans
-
Safety system calibrations
Post-repair inspections help confirm the vehicle has been restored according to repair specifications.
